MySQL作为一种广泛使用的数据库管理系统,其表结构的导出需求尤为常见
本文将详细介绍如何将MySQL中所有表的结构导出为Excel文件,以便更高效地进行数据管理和分析
一、导出需求的重要性 在数据库的日常维护中,导出表结构至Excel的重要性不言而喻
Excel作为一种普及度极高的电子表格软件,其强大的数据处理和分析功能深受用户喜爱
将MySQL表结构导出为Excel文件,不仅可以方便地查看和编辑表结构信息,还能利用Excel的各种功能进行数据分析、比对和可视化呈现
二、导出前的准备工作 在进行导出操作之前,我们需要确保以下几点: 1.MySQL数据库的正常运行:确保MySQL数据库服务已启动,且你有足够的权限访问和导出所需的表结构
2.导出工具的选择:虽然MySQL自身提供了命令行导出工具(如mysqldump),但为了方便地导出为Excel格式,我们可能需要借助第三方工具或编程语言(如Python、PHP等)来实现
3.数据安全性考虑:在导出过程中,要确保数据的安全性,避免敏感信息的泄露或被非法访问
三、导出步骤详解 以下是一个基于常见场景的MySQL表结构导出为Excel的步骤指南: 步骤1:选择合适的导出工具 根据你的实际需求和操作习惯,选择一个合适的导出工具
这可以是图形界面的数据库管理工具(如Navicat、DataGrip等),也可以是编程脚本(如使用Python的pandas和openpyxl库)
步骤2:连接到MySQL数据库 使用所选工具连接到MySQL数据库
这通常需要提供数据库的地址、端口、用户名和密码等信息
步骤3:选择要导出的表 在数据库管理工具中,浏览并选择你想要导出结构的表
如果你需要导出所有表的结构,确保选择了整个数据库或所有表
步骤4:配置导出选项 在导出设置中,选择“导出表结构”或类似选项,以确保只导出表的结构而不是数据
同时,选择Excel作为导出格式,并设置相关的Excel选项(如工作表名称、列宽等)
步骤5:执行导出操作 点击“导出”或类似按钮,开始执行导出操作
根据表的数量和大小,这可能需要一些时间
步骤6:检查并保存导出的Excel文件 导出完成后,打开生成的Excel文件,检查表结构是否正确导出
确认无误后,保存文件以备后用
四、注意事项与常见问题解答 1.权限问题:确保你拥有足够的权限来访问和导出所需的表结构
如果遇到权限错误,请联系数据库管理员
2.字符集问题:在导出过程中,注意字符集的设置,以避免乱码问题
3.大表导出:对于包含大量表的数据库,导出可能需要较长时间
在这种情况下,可以考虑分批导出或使用更高效的导出工具
4.Excel版本兼容性:不同的Excel版本可能对导出的文件格式有不同的要求
确保你使用的Excel版本能够打开和编辑导出的文件
五、结语 将MySQL中所有表的结构导出为Excel文件,是一个既实用又高效的操作
通过本文的介绍,相信你已经掌握了这一技能
在未来的数据库管理工作中,不妨尝试运用这一方法,提升你的工作效率和数据分析能力